Toulouse gunman captured, hostages released

Sapa-AP | 20 June, 2012 17:36
Special French GIPN intervention police prepare equipment at the scene where a man claiming to be a member of al Qaeda has taken hostages in a bank in Toulouse, June 20, 2012.
Image by: STRINGER / Reuters

A French police official says that a gunman who had taken four people hostage in a bank in Toulouse has been captured, and the hostages released.

Regional police official Frederic Tamisier says the hostage-taker was lightly injured in the operation to capture him. The hostages were unharmed, he said.

The announcement came soon after a series of gunshots were heard from the area of the bank.

Authorities say the gunman had psychiatric problems in the past and claimed he was acting for religious reasons. French media reports said he claimed allegiance to al-Qaida.
